Output 3df18c0019100bf87b8cb98fa4174f6da0049c08fe56976cd43be3e8de7c82f4:1

value
10924436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f74c1b3d70ad6375b55c39bd3926eae6e83af2 OP_EQUAL
address
3D5mxr7x344FzocpbJWv5WCZeJ7WCzAv1C
transaction
3df18c0019100bf87b8cb98fa4174f6da0049c08fe56976cd43be3e8de7c82f4
spent
true